Hi Paul,

I usually use 2014 at home, however trying to test some stuff in the trial of 2013 and getting the following error(see attached image). Revit 2013 was installed recently with all updates - the usual folder (C:\Program Files\Autodesk\Revit 2013\Program). I'm using the Octane for Revit installer at the start of this thread.

Any clues what's causing this error? I've frustrated all my options

p.s. The .addin file seems to install to C:\ProgramData\Autodesk\Revit\Addins\2012 rather than C:\ProgramData\Autodesk\Revit\Addins\2013 - I moved it manually - which worked on my mates computer, but not on mine. not sure if its related. I doubt it, since with the .addin in the wrong place the plugin doesn't even attempt to load, whereas in my case it tried to load but cant seem to find the dll...

Hi Andrew - can you tell me exactly what version you are installing pls (ie. the installer filename)?

EDIT: And what Nvidia drivers are you on pls?
p.s. The .addin file seems to install to C:\ProgramData\Autodesk\Revit\Addins\2012 rather than C:\ProgramData\Autodesk\Revit\Addins\2013 - I moved it manually - which worked on my mates computer, but not on mine. not sure if its related. I doubt it, since with the .addin in the wrong place the plugin doesn't even attempt to load, whereas in my case it tried to load but cant seem to find the dll...
If you have Nvidia drivers prior to the version stated at the top of this thread, the plugin will not be able to find/load the dll.
